Dr. Sarvepalli Radhakrishnan, the first vice-president and second president of Independent India, was also one of its foremost thinkers and visionaries. He was also known widely as a teacher, which is why his birth anniversary is celebrated every year as Teachers' Day. He believed that teachers must be accorded the highest honour, since their role in nation-building is very crucial. He has written several books, of which Bhagvadgita is the best-loved.
